Disagree with this.

Roquan would be a very good MLB. He might be an even better WLB and the same could be said for Hicks, but that doesn't mean they can't play in the middle. They are both very smart instinctive players that while not the best shedders can find their way to the ball carrier.

The game is moving away from the big MLBs of the past with how pass-centric the league has become and how you need a MLB that can really cover, especially in a 4-3. They have to cover the most ground of any LB. I mean if you can find an instinctive LB that has great size and impressive athleticism, then you hit the gold mine. Those guys like Luke Kuechly are very rare though.

If anything the LB that needs to be bigger and able to shed the best is the SLB, but really all the LB positions in our defense will have to take on blockers at the 2nd level more than most defenses since its so predicated on getting penetration up the field.
